目录

  • 实验内容:
  • 实验要求:
  • 实验内容:
    • 1.在PC机上下载安装IIS,学习IIS的组成和功能,以及IIS的使用方法
    • 2.分别在本机进行WebServer、EmailServer、FTPServer的配置设计
      • WebServer:
      • FTPServer:
      • EmailServer:
    • 3.通过另外一台接入互联网的PC机(或自己的手机)的通用客户程序(浏览器或DOS终端)访问自己设置的WebServer、EmailServer、FTPServer

实验内容:

(1) 在PC机上下载安装IIS,学习IIS的组成和功能,以及IIS的使用方法。
(2) 分别在本机进行WebServer、EmailServer、FTPServer的配置设计;
(3) 通过另外一台接入互联网的PC机(或自己的手机)的通用客户程序(浏览器或DOS终端)访问自己设置的WebServer、EmailServer、FTPServer。

实验要求:

(1) 提前熟知Web服务、Email服务、FTP服务的功能、特点及其组成内容;
(2) 分别进行Web服务、Email服务、FTP服务的单独配置及单独开启和测试,以及三个服务同时配置和开启下的测试。

实验内容:

1.在PC机上下载安装IIS,学习IIS的组成和功能,以及IIS的使用方法

IS是一种Web(网页)服务组件,其中包括Web服务器、FTP服务器、NNTP服务器和SMTP服务器,分别用于网页浏览、文件传输、新闻服务和邮件发送等方面,它使得在网络(包括互联网和局域网)上发布信息成了一件很容易的事。

IIS的安装:点击开始→控制面板,然后再点击程序。然后在程序和功能下面,点击打开和关闭windows功能。进入Windows功能窗口,然后看到internet信息服务选项,全选。然后确定,会进入系统安装设置,安装成功后,窗口会消失,然后回到控制面板,选择系统和安全。进入系统和安全窗口,然后选择左下角的管理工具。进入管理工具窗口,此时就可以看到internet信息服务了,选择internet信息服务(IIS)管理器。


右键计算机名,添加网站。大致操作为:右键“网站”->“添加网站”->输入信息->点击“确定”即可,其中,“网站名称”任意填写,“物理路径”选择上面放了网站相关文件的目录路径,端口为80或者其他未占用端口,点击确定。

在目录下编写一个HTML页面,代码内容如下

<!DOCTYPE html>
<html>
<head><meta charset="utf-8"><title>jiwangshiyan4</title>
</head>
<body>
<p1>Hello World!</p1>
</body>
</html>

然后在本机浏览器目录下输入对应的IP地址也就是刚刚设定IP,浏览器上有回显内容

2.分别在本机进行WebServer、EmailServer、FTPServer的配置设计

WebServer:

上网下载一个ASP源码,然后放在所设定的网页目录下,设置默认网站访问index1.html,并且配置相关信息。

本机访问http://169.254.75.6/,浏览器显示如图:

FTPServer:

从控制面板里面找到程序然后去选择打开或关闭windows功能,选择FTP服务器的选项,展开Internet信息服务,将FTP服务、FTP扩展性、IIS控管理台选中

然后就开始配置FTP服务器,选中一个目录用来存放你提供访问以及下载的文件,电脑的C盘下设置C:\FTP,该目录下有很多子目录供访问,上传和下载。 然后在IIS管理器里面新建一个FTP站点,设置相关的信息。


然后设置身份信息还有权限,设置匿名用户的话就允许其他人访问了,如果有特殊要求再设置其他用户类型,点击完成就可以开启该服务了。

在本机浏览器上输入自己设定的IP,ftp://10.4.39.129,浏览器上显示目标文件夹内的所有文件,并支持下载,如图:

EmailServer:

网络拓扑图如图所示:

PC1还有PC2的IP设置如下:


MAIL和DNS服务器的IP地址设置:


然后再配置DNS服务器里面的相关域名:

然后配置邮箱服务器,这里要配置的两个用户名与密码跟后面PC1和PC2配置的要一致。

然后在PC1和PC2里面配置相对应邮件信息


点击PC1邮件功能里面的创建,编辑发送邮件的信息,然后发送

从PC2接受里查看接受的信息,收到刚才发送的信息了

3.通过另外一台接入互联网的PC机(或自己的手机)的通用客户程序(浏览器或DOS终端)访问自己设置的WebServer、EmailServer、FTPServer

手机访问Webserver,也就是172.20.10.2:8080,手机上显示网页信息,搭建成功

手机访问FTPserver,填写好信息,搭建成功


对于邮箱服务器用PC1跟PC2互相发送邮件,正常接收,搭建成功

【计算机网络】网络服务器配置设计相关推荐

  1. 计算机网络——网络聊天程序的设计与实现

    计算机网络--网络聊天程序的设计与实现 一.实验目的 二.总体设计 1. 基本原理 2. 设计步骤 (1)服务器端编程的步骤 (2)客户端编程的步骤 三.详细设计 1. 程序流程图 2. 实验代码 ( ...

  2. 计算机网络无线局域网设计,《计算机网络》网络课程“无线局域网”单元的设计与开发...

    摘要: 教育信息化高速发展的现今,网络课程的应用已经受到越来越多学习者或者研究学者的重视,网络课程跨越时空限制,共享优质资源,利用网络实时交互等等特点已经让传统学校教育工作受到一定的冲击.如何更有效率 ...

  3. 系统架构师论文-论计算机网络的安全性设计(证券网络交易系统)

    论计算机网络的安全性设计 -证券网络交易系统 [摘要] 我在一家证券公司信息技术部门工作,我公司在97-98年建成了与各公司总部及营业网点的企业网络,并已先后在企业网络上建设了交易系统.办公系统,并开 ...

  4. 计算机网络高校校园网设计思路,浅谈高校信息化校园网络设计及教育应用

    摘 要: 信息化校园主要是以校园网为基础,将网络化.智能化.数字化和应用化作为发展目标,将校园信息充分数字化.其中所谓的校园网就是指校园内连接起来的计算机网络,它可以将信息管理.教学管理.行政管理等结 ...

  5. python网络爬虫课程设计题目_山东建筑大学计算机网络课程设计《基于Python的网络爬虫设计》...

    山东建筑大学计算机网络课程设计<基于Python的网络爬虫设计> 山东建筑大学 课 程 设 计 成 果 报 告 题 目: 基于Python的网络爬虫设计 课 程: 计算机网络A 院 (部) ...

  6. 计算机网络课程设计小程序,网络课程设计(简单聊天系统的设计与实现).doc

    网络课程设计(简单聊天系统的设计与实现) 简单聊天程序的设计与实现 摘 要 本课程设计主要是设计并实现一个简单的聊天程序,该聊天程序能够支持多人聊天,聊天的内容可以仅仅支持文本信息,聊天程序包括服务器 ...

  7. 计算机网络实验-实验四 无线网络的设计

    实验四 无线网络的设计 本次实验最应该注意的便是网关的作用 实验四 无线网络的设计 1.首先明确概念总共有两个路由器,一个是无线路由器,另一个是有线路由器.所以有线路由器这边直连交换机,交换机再连接A ...

  8. 新书推荐——Windows Server 2019 网络服务器配置与管理

    新书推荐--Windows Server 2019 网络服务器配置与管理 近日,正月十六工作室组编的<Windows Server 2019 网络服务器配置与管理>在电子工业出版社正式出版 ...

  9. 南通大学计算机网络及应用,南通大学《计算机网络》课程设计资料.pdf

    南 通 大 学 课 设 计 报 告 课程名称 : _____ 课题名称 : 课设二 学 号 : ___ 姓 名 : 梁博生 ________ 班 级 : 网工 131________ 计算机科学与技术 ...

最新文章

  1. Block Token 原理分析
  2. ubuntu 挂载新硬盘
  3. 苹果也像谷歌一样,玩起了自己的X
  4. mysql+io+参数_MySQL IO线程及相关参数调优
  5. SAP 电商云 Spartacus UI Component 级别的延迟加载实现(Lazy Load)
  6. java tostring格式_如何在Java中使用toString()获得数字的字符串表示形式?
  7. USTC 1119 graph 图的同构
  8. Fedora9中安装中文输入法
  9. DSP eQEP正交编码
  10. 计算机管理中优盘显示无媒体,无法识别、无媒体、无容量等的U盘,是怎么造成的?(故障篇)...
  11. mysql汉字按英文字母排序
  12. 指标公式c语言源码下载,【通达信】九全指标-指标公式源码
  13. 购买别人的域名回收别人废弃的域名
  14. Java同步技术(十)
  15. java分类读txt里面的数据_java分别读取两个txt文件里的数据再进行比较。再分别列出这两个文件中共有的和分别独有的数据。...
  16. 本机如何传文件到VMware 中
  17. 【实时数仓】Day04-DWS层业务:DWS设计、访客宽表、商品主题宽表、流合并、地区主题表、FlinkSQL、关键词主题表、分词...
  18. 如何处理输入框的不允许输入空格
  19. 【手把手带你Godot游戏开发 第二弹】名场面临摹(教程目录 10月30日 更新)
  20. 【Python-GUI】初识窗体-wxPython基础语法

热门文章

  1. BQ40Z80 SMBUS通讯不上
  2. 用于多UxV管理的人机协作中智能体的透明度研究
  3. 关于Mybatis 异常BindingException: Type interface XXXX is not known to the MapperRegistry.
  4. 80后站长建站的经验总结
  5. 迅睿CMS 推荐位管理
  6. 蘑菇云「行空板Python入门教程」第六课:贪吃蛇小游戏
  7. C++头文件中cstring和string的区别
  8. 第2章 人员安全和风险管理的概念
  9. 2、SPSS的基本知识
  10. 如何进行科学的技术选型